A fuel cell power system comprises at least one fuel cell and a cooling circuit in which coolant is intended to circulate for regulating temperature of the at least one fuel cell. The cooling circuit comprises a ram air heat exchanger, and the fuel power system further comprises a controller configured for: regulating temperature of the coolant according to a first target temperature in nominal operations; when receiving an event, referred to as first event, indicating that the fuel cell power system shall prepare for highly demanding electrical energy situation or cooling low availability situation, regulating temperature of the coolant according to a second target temperature lower than the first target temperature. Thus, dimensioning of a ram air system which includes the ram air heat exchanger is reduced.
